Cup of Milk Coffee — Frequently Asked Questions

How many calories are in milk coffee?

Milk coffee contains 38 calories per 100 g. It also provides 1.7 g of protein, 4.6 g of carbohydrates, and 1.2 g of fat per 100 g.

Is milk coffee low glycemic?

Milk coffee has a glycemic index of 27, which is in the low-GI range. It contains dairy, so it is not suitable for people with a dairy allergy.
